Reference Overview
A concise snapshot of key islands helps clarify scope, scale, and strategic relevance.
| Island | Region | Area (km²) | Key Role |
|---|---|---|---|
| Franz Josef Land | Arctic Ocean | 16,134 | Remote research & ecological reserve |
| Sakhalin | Sea of Okhotsk | 72,493 | Energy hub, pipelines to Asia |
| Kuril Islands | Northwest Pacific | 10,503 | Disputed chain, fishing & military |
| Severnaya Zemlya | Kara Sea | 37,000 | Glaciology, emerging shipping route |
Arctic Shipping & Geopolitics
As climate change thins polar ice, islands above Russia become pivotal nodes in new maritime corridors, reshaping cargo flows and regional influence.
Northern Sea Route Infrastructure
Along the Northern Sea Route, islands host icebreakers, radar stations, and emergency response hubs that reduce transit risk for commercial and military vessels.
Strategic Positioning
Control over these outposts allows Russia to project power across the Arctic, monitor NATO activity, and secure hydrocarbon claims under the extended continental shelf.
Environmental and Safety Concerns
Harsh conditions, limited infrastructure, and sensitive ecosystems demand stringent safety protocols, raising costs but also driving innovation in cold-weather logistics.
Energy Resources and Economic Impact
Several island regions underpin Russia’s hydrocarbon strategy, offering offshore oil, gas, and wind potential that stabilizes federal budgets and local employment.
Sakhalin Energy Projects
Sakhalin-2 and related ventures link massive gas reserves to Asian markets, using export terminals and pipelines that anchor long term revenue streams.
Renewables and Microgrids
Wind potential around the Kurils and hybrid solar-diesel systems on remote islands are gradually cutting diesel dependence while improving energy security.
Ecological Diversity and Conservation
Islands above Russia host endemic species, critical bird migration routes, and marine nurseries, prompting strict protected-area designations and international research partnerships.
Franz Josef Land Biosphere Reserve
Designated as a UNESCO-associated biosphere, this archipelago limits industrial activity and prioritizes monitoring of polar bears, walruses, and seabird colonies.
Marine Protected Areas
Large ocean zones around the Kurils and Sakhalin restrict trawling and drilling, supporting fish stocks that underpin regional food security and export revenues.

How do islands above Russia influence global shipping costs?
They provide refueling, repair, and shelter points on the Northern Sea Route, lowering fuel consumption and insurance premiums for Asia-Europe cargo in summer months.
What political tensions are linked to the Kuril Islands?
The unresolved sovereignty dispute with Japan complicates peace treaties, joint fishing agreements, and cross-border infrastructure investment across the region.
Can renewable energy on islands compete with fossil fuels?
High upfront capital and maintenance costs currently favor hydrocarbons, but falling technology prices and carbon policies are shifting economics toward wind and hybrid microgrids.
What role does climate change play in island logistics?
Thinning ice enables new shipping lanes and construction windows, yet unpredictable ice conditions and permafrost thaw demand reinforced ports and resilient design.
